2.8 Hydraulic fluids
2.8.1 General
The selection of the suitable hydraulic fluid is substantially influenced by the expected operating temperature
depending on the ambient temperature that is equivalent to the tank temperature.
Use the comparative oil values for the selection of the suitable hydraulic fluid. see chapter 2.8.5
2.8.2 Operating limits
Depending on the operating temperature, the appropriate oil must be selected taking into account the viscosity cha-
racteristics according to the following conditions:
- Cold start: max. approx. 1600 mm
2
/s *
- Normal operation: at or above approx. 500 mm
2
/s *
- Optimal range of application: 16-36 mm
2
/s *
-
At max. leakage-oil temperature, the viscosity must not be below 8 mm
2
/s (short term, meaning < 3 min., 7mm
2
/s).
- The shear stability (KRL) has to be observed for multigrade oils.
*) open circuit: relative to reservoir temperature
Closed circuit: relative to circuit temperature
In addition to the viscosity characteristics, the Liebherr GSP specification ID No. 10465804 must be observed.

2.8.4 Filtering
- To maintain the specified purity class "21/17/14 according to ISO 4406" under all circumstances,
filtering the hydraulic fluid is required.
- The hydraulic fluid is filtered by means of the device-specific use of oil filters in the hydraulic system.
- Cleaning and maintenance intervals of the oil filter and for the entire oil circuit depend on the
device usage, and are found in the device-specific operating manual.
ATTENTION
Mixing various mineral oil pressure fluids is prohibited!
Note
The hydraulic unit must be filled with oil and bled prior to initialization.
This must be inspected during operation and after extended downtime, and must be
repeated as necessary!
